Due to the recent May 8 2022 error which saw Singapore dollar sellers significantly overcharged in fees, Etsy has now started to cancel and fully refund orders. Even on Singapore dollar accounts with completed orders which were not affected!

I woke up today to find that Etsy canceled and fully refunded a SGD $231.21 order that had already been completed and shipped off to the buyer! So now the buyer has a free item and I have that outstanding amount in my payment account page!

Even the listing which originated the sale has been completely removed. It can no longer be found anywhere on my Shop Manager nor through search.

Additionally, the threads started here by other sellers related to this May 8 2022 issue have been locked.

etsy did this to sellers in Denmark a few years ago,

people bought items for around $22000, but at the exchange rate was wrong, they only charged the customer around $100

customers were doing a  lot of buying, as the items were cheap,

etsy cancelled and refunded a lot of expensive orders, that were already sent

They eventually made the sellers right, but it took a long time, and hassling, for it to happen.

Hello fellow sellers, I woke up a short while ago to good news! Etsy has updated my payments account with a full credit that corrects the error refund! It was listed as "Credit for sale(s) from currency conversion issue on 8 May".

An update via email conversation was also received from Etsy:

Good day! I'm one of the seller specialist on Etsy and thank you for reaching out to us explaining your thoughts and situation.

We started fixing the incorrect charges on impacted payment accounts. We have canceled and refunded any impacted orders placed during this time period. Sellers affected by this issue should see those sales and related fees corrected on their payment accounts. We also alerted buyers and encouraged them to re-order from the sellers. We also sent an email to impacted sellers letting them know that we had resolved the issue. We apologize for the confusion this email may have caused, we realize that some remaining fees that were not related to a sale were also charged during this time period. We’re actively working on resolving this issue for any remaining impacted accounts. Sellers should see these fees refunded and payment accounts corrected in the coming days. We appreciate your patience as we work through remediating this matter.
